| The port commodity trading need to occupy a lot of funds of traders.Therefore,traders often need to apply for financing from commercial banks,and pledge the stockists to banks to obtain operating funds.In recent years,however,due to information asymmetry between banks and traders,it's difficult to verify the ownership and authenticity of warehouse receipts,a lot of counterfeiting warehouse receipts and repeated pledges by traders have frequently occurred,which has brought great financing risks to banks.Blockchain has technical advantages such as immutability,decentralization and traceable,which can solve the problem of information asymmetry among business members,also can provide authentic proof of ownership,which has a high degree of compatibility with the port commodity trade financing.Based on the key obstacles of port commodity trade financing,this thesis builds a block chain-based port commodity trade financing mode.The system architecture,data sharing and verification scheme,chain code structure,transaction accounting method and trade finance process of the port bulk commodity trade financing have been designed.In the blockchain mode,banks can eliminate the asymmetry of logistics information with traders.Moreover,the block chain can influence the financing behavior of traders from the two dimensions of adverse selection and moral hazard,making it less likely that traders will choose to default at the end of the period.This article builds a loan-to-value ratio decision model of bank based on the blockchain.Under the blockchain mode,banks no longer need to consider the possibility of traders counterfeiting warehouse receipts or repeated pledges,only need to consider the impact of changes in the market order quantity and the total value of the quality market on the performance of traders.Based on these,the bank's expected return segmentation function is constructed,with the goal of maximizing the expected return,the bank's lower side of risk limits strategy is taken into account at the same time,finally the bank's optimal expected return and the highest loan-to-value ratio are calculated.Finally,the example numerical analysis and sensitivity analysis have been performed.It is found that the expected revenue of banks and the loan-to-value ratio are inversely related to the fluctuation of the order volume,and are positively correlated with the change of discount rate of pledged goods.The bank loan-to-value ratio decision model under the blockchain mode is compared with the traditional mode,and it is found that the maximum expected revenue and the highest loan-to-value ratio are better than the traditional mode,which is because under the traditional mode,traders may have counterfeiting warehouse receipt or repeated pledges possibility,and when the total market value of pledged goods is lower than the financing principal and interest,the default probability of the trader is higher.In the blockchain mode,banks can obtain higher revenue,and traders can obtain higher loan-to-value ratio.Hence,this mode is beneficial to both financing parties and can effectively promote commodity trading business development. |
